## Step 4: Tune spreadsheet export memory before cutover

The legacy Gridhaven exporter built entire workbooks in memory, which is why exports over 200k rows used to OOM the worker pods. The new streaming exporter writes row batches directly to object storage, but it only behaves well if the batch and buffer settings are sized for your pod memory limits. Undersized buffers cause thrashing; oversized ones recreate the old OOM problem. Before enabling streaming mode for any tenant, apply the recommended baseline configuration shown here.

service settings:
[casax]
port = 6379
team = rusir
host = casax.zemvarhq.corp
region = outer-4
access_code = ac_9808ce
timeout_ms = 1500

**ALERT: ORDER_CUTOFF_BREACH — Crumbline**

Severity: high. Fires when the Crumbline storefront accepts bakery orders after the 18:00 cutoff for next-morning fulfillment. Root cause is usually a timezone drift in the cutoff evaluator after a config push. Impact: ovens at the Larkfield kitchen get orders they cannot fulfill, triggering manual refunds. Do not roll forward until the cutoff clock is verified against the fulfillment calendar. Remediation steps and the verification checklist are maintained on the internal page below.

operations page: https://jira.lumiclabs.internal/pages/display/projects/af69ce92

### Changelog 3.2 — Undo/Redo defaults changed (Sketchloom). Heads up: undo history in the diagram editor now defaults to 200 steps instead of 50, and redo survives a canvas switch. Power users kept losing work, so we flipped it. If your plugin pokes the history stack, retest against the new limits. The defaults now shipped with the editor are as follows:

config for bahop-fajep:
DRUATH_PIN=4501
DRUATH_TENANT=briwyn
DRUATH_METRICS_HOST=metrics.druath.brasksoft.test
DRUATH_SEAL=seal_7d2e069d
DRUATH_STANDBY_TEAM=olieth

Handover, night shift — Kestrel Wharf. Quiet room on the top floor is back in use after the carpet fix. Keep the window cracked, the heater overshoots. Log any use in the night book as before. The keypad was reset this afternoon; the new door code is below.

staff pass of tajof-fawif = bdg-CW-8